Heart-to-Heart heals division by developing peace leaders in tension-filled contexts with urgent needs. We form learning communities through which emerging leaders develop four skills essential for personal and societal healing. These are Mindfulness, Empathy, Decision making, and Conflict transformation (MEDC).

What We Do

Heart-to-Heart develops peace leaders in tension-filled contexts, operating in correctional facilities and community settings. Our work builds on Dr. Marshall Rosenberg’s Nonviolent Communication and other sources. Strongly influenced by Gandhi, Dr. Rosenberg’s approach offers a powerful framework for understanding ourselves, empathizing with other people, and communicating in a way that acknowledges and cares about everyone’s needs.
